feat(context-mgmt): introduce EL3/root context

* This patch adds root context procedure to restore/configure
  the registers, which are of importance during EL3 execution.

* EL3/Root context is a simple restore operation that overwrites
  the following bits: (MDCR_EL3.SDD, SCR_EL3.{EA, SIF}, PMCR_EL0.DP
  PSTATE.DIT) while the execution is in EL3.

* It ensures EL3 world maintains its own settings distinct
  from other worlds (NS/Realm/SWd). With this in place, the EL3
  system register settings is no longer influenced by settings of
  incoming worlds. This allows the EL3/Root world to access features
  for its own execution at EL3 (eg: Pauth).

* It should be invoked at cold and warm boot entry paths and also
  at all the possible exception handlers routing to EL3 at runtime.
  Cold and warm boot paths are handled by including setup_el3_context
  function in  "el3_entrypoint_common"  macro, which gets invoked in
  both the entry paths.

* At runtime, el3_context is setup at the stage, while we get prepared
  to enter into EL3 via "prepare_el3_entry" routine.

+/*-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
+ * Helper macro to configure EL3 registers we care about, while executing
+ * at EL3/Root world. Root world has its own execution environment and
+ * needs to have its settings configured to be independent of other worlds.
+ * -----------------------------------------------------------------------------
+ */
+	.macro setup_el3_execution_context
+
+	/* ---------------------------------------------------------------------
+	 * The following registers need to be part of separate root context
+	 * as their values are of importance during EL3 execution.
+	 * Hence these registers are overwritten to their intital values,
+	 * irrespective of whichever world they return from to ensure EL3 has a
+	 * consistent execution context throughout the lifetime of TF-A.
+	 *
+	 * DAIF.A: Enable External Aborts and SError Interrupts at EL3.
+	 *
+	 * MDCR_EL3.SDD: Set to one to disable AArch64 Secure self-hosted debug.
+	 *  Debug exceptions, other than Breakpoint Instruction exceptions, are
+	 *  disabled from all ELs in Secure state.
+	 *
+	 * SCR_EL3.EA: Set to one to enable SError interrupts at EL3.
+	 *
+	 * SCR_EL3.SIF: Set to one to disable instruction fetches from
+	 *  Non-secure memory.
+	 *
+	 * PMCR_EL0.DP: Set to one so that the cycle counter,
+	 *  PMCCNTR_EL0 does not count when event counting is prohibited.
+	 *  Necessary on PMUv3 <= p7 where MDCR_EL3.{SCCD,MCCD} are not
+	 *  available.
+	 *
+	 * PSTATE.DIT: Set to one to enable the Data Independent Timing (DIT)
+	 *  functionality, if implemented in EL3.
+	 * ---------------------------------------------------------------------
+	 */
